Foram encontradas 13.789 questões

Resolva questões gratuitamente!

Junte-se a mais de 4 milhões de concurseiros!

Q249860 Banco de Dados
O Microsoft SQL Server 2008 possui diversas funções incorporadas. Dentre elas, há uma função que calcula o intervalo entre duas datas. Trata-se da função

Alternativas
Q249837 Banco de Dados
No Microsoft SQL Server 2008, há um comando para desfazer uma transação desde o seu início ou até um comando de Savepoint, dentro da transação. Esse comando é o

Alternativas
Q249836 Banco de Dados
No comando de criação de indices do Microsoft SQL Server 2008, há três tipos de indices, os quais são:

Alternativas
Q249835 Banco de Dados
O Microsoft SQL Server 2008 tem incorporados diversos comandos. Considere os seguintes comandos:

TRUNC (125.382, 2) e TRUNC (125.382, -2)

Os resultados da execução desses dois comandos são, respectivamente,

Alternativas
Q249834 Banco de Dados
O Microsoft SQL Server 2008 possui diversas funções incorporadas. Dentre elas, há uma função que verifica se uma expressão do tipo de dados datetime ou smalldatetime é uma data ou tempo válidos. Trata-se da função

Alternativas
Q237761 Banco de Dados
Considere a escala concorrente de transações a seguir.

Imagem associada para resolução da questão
onde:
lock-Sk (p ) – a transação k solicita bloqueio em modo compartilhado do item p.
lock-Xk (p) – a transação k solicita bloqueio em modo exclusivo do item p.
uk (p) – a transação k desbloqueia o item p.
r k (p) – a transação k lê o item p.
wk (p) – a transação k escreve o item p.

A escala S apresenta um problema, cuja solução obtém-se com a utilização do algoritmo
Alternativas
Q237760 Banco de Dados
Uma das técnicas empregadas por Sistemas Gerenciadores de Bancos de Dados, para implementar o controle de transações concorrentes, é a utilização de bloqueios.
Para garantir a serialização da escala concorrente de várias transações, deve(m)-se empregar o(s)
Alternativas
Q237759 Banco de Dados
Um banco de dados relacional possui um conjunto de relações, cujo esquema é apresentado a seguir.

T1 (a, b, c, d)
T2 (d, e)

Considere que:
• os atributos sublinhados de forma contínua são chaves primárias de suas respectivas tabelas;
• todos os atributos em todas as tabelas são numéricos;
• o atributo d na tabela T1 é chave estrangeira do atributo d da tabela T2; e
• as tabelas T1 e T2, ambas inicialmente não contendo tuplas, tenham sobre elas executados, respectivamente, os seguintes comandos:
INSERT INTO T2
VALUES (10,40),(23,52),(60,37),(31,13),(45,54),(35,10);
INSERT INTO T1
VALUES (1,0,4,60),(2,3,5,35), (3,4,8,31),(4,21,6,60),(5,7,7,10), (6,9,21,31),(7,3,2,23),(8,6,5,45),(9,0,0,31),(10,1,8,60);
SELECT Y.e
FROM T1 X JOIN T2 Y ON X.d = Y.d
GROUP BY Y.e
HAVING max(c) > (SELECT avg(c) FROM T1 Y) 

Quantas linhas há na tabela resultante da execução do comando SELECT?
Alternativas
Q237758 Banco de Dados
Considere o modelo entidade-relacionamento (MER) a seguir.
Imagem 016.jpg

Sabendo-se que todas as entidades foram mapeadas em tabelas do modelo relacional e que as chaves primárias das relações criadas são simples (constituídas por apenas um único atributo), quantas chaves estrangeiras podem aparecer no modelo produzido?
Alternativas
Q237757 Banco de Dados
Observe o diagrama de transição de estado de transações, apresentado a seguir. Imagem 015.jpg

Sejam os eventos:
• BEGIN TRANSACTION - Marca o início da execução de uma transação.
• END TRANSACTION - Marca o término da execução de uma transação.
• READ, WRITE - Representam as operações de leitura e escrita de uma transação.
• COMMIT - Indica término com sucesso da transação, com as alterações realizadas refletidas na base de dados.
• ABORT - Indica que uma transação não terminou com sucesso.

Ao relacionar esse diagrama às propriedades ACID (Atomicidade, Consistência, Isolamento e Durabilidade), tem-se que estará garantido(a)
Alternativas
Ano: 2011 Banca: FDC Órgão: CREMERJ Prova: FDC - 2011 - CREMERJ - Técnico de Informática |
Q237236 Banco de Dados
Um banco de dados possui duas tabelas, apresentadas abaixo.

Imagem 033.jpg

Um DBA precisa gerar uma terceira tabela Resultado com as seguintes especificações:

– Conter Nome, Marca e Modelo, obtidos a partir das duas tabelas;

– Ter seleção realizada exclusivamente para carros com a mesma placa nas duas tabelas;

– Apresentar os dados ordenados de forma descendente por Marca e em ordem ascendente por Nome.

O comando SQL que gera essa tabela Resultado é
Alternativas
Ano: 2011 Banca: FDC Órgão: CREMERJ Prova: FDC - 2011 - CREMERJ - Técnico de Informática |
Q237228 Banco de Dados
Em um banco de dados relacional, um termo importante é conhecido por integridade referencial, definido como uma regra que atende à seguinte condição:
Alternativas
Q220782 Banco de Dados
Em relação às tabelas de banco de dados denominadas HEAP, InnoDB e BDB, é correto afirmar que pertencem a ,
Alternativas
Q220746 Banco de Dados
Para
Alternativas
Q220696 Banco de Dados
O PL/SQL
Alternativas
Q220695 Banco de Dados
Instrução: Para responder às questões 43 e 44, considere o modelo de dados apresentado abaixo.

Imagem 005.jpg

Consta uma instrução SQL INCORRETA em:
Alternativas
Q220694 Banco de Dados
Instrução: Para responder às questões 43 e 44, considere o modelo de dados apresentado abaixo.

Imagem 005.jpg

Analise:
I. É possível inserir, na tabela DEPT, uma linha com os valores 10, 'Operations', 'Rio de Janeiro' e outra linha com os valores 10,'Sales','São Paulo'.
II. É possível inserir, na tabela EMP, várias linhas com o mesmo valor para o campo DeptNo.
III. A notação usada para exibir o modelo foi uma notação EER que exibe intervalos (EER [1,n]).
IV. A notação utilizada para exibir o modelo foi uma notação crows foot, que exibe intervalos (crows foot [1,n]).

Está correto o que consta em
Alternativas
Q220630 Banco de Dados
Dada a função em PostGreSQL:

                  substring('ABCX454545DEF' from 'A[^0-9]*([0-9]{1,3})')

Após a sua execução, o resultado será:
Alternativas
Q220629 Banco de Dados
A função INSERT(), em MySql, é utilizada para
Alternativas
Q220628 Banco de Dados
Procedure, em PL/SQL, é um bloco de comandos
Alternativas
Respostas
11821: A
11822: D
11823: A
11824: D
11825: C
11826: C
11827: A
11828: C
11829: D
11830: C
11831: E
11832: C
11833: A
11834: A
11835: D
11836: C
11837: B
11838: C
11839: E
11840: A